About Fresenius Medical Financial Statements

There are typically three primary documents that fall into the category of financial statements. These documents include Fresenius Medical income statement, its balance sheet, and the statement of cash flows. Fresenius Medical investors use historical funamental indicators, such as Fresenius Medical's Consolidated Income, to determine how well the company is positioned to perform in the future. Although Fresenius Medical investors may use each financial statement separately, they are all related. The changes in Fresenius Medical's assets and liabilities, for example, are also reflected in the revenues and expenses that we see on Fresenius Medical's income statement, which results in the company's gains or losses. Cash flows can provide more information regarding cash listed on a balance sheet, but not equivalent to net income shown on the income statement. KGaA provides dialysis care and related dialysis care services in Germany, North America, and internationally. KGaA was incorporated in 1996 and is headquartered in Bad Homburg, Germany. Fresenius Medical is traded on New York Stock Exchange in the United States.

The market value of Fresenius Medical Care is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of Fresenius that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of Fresenius Medical's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is Fresenius Medical's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because Fresenius Medical's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ect Fresenius Medical's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between Fresenius Medical's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if Fresenius Medical is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, Fresenius Medical's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
